A huge trend I saw this year on the runways was the re-mixed smoky eye. I say remixed because the “smoky eye” is no longer just boring shades of gray and black, but different hues of colors. Recently I got my hands on the Stila Spring 2010 Jeweled eye palette, and I’m already envisioning creating a gorgeous sparkly purple smoky eye with this palette. The colors are so pigmented, and bold, and oh so sparkly (I love sparkles) Any shade of purple on the eyes is always a gorgeous for brown eyed women, and this palette feels like it was created just for my big brown eyes.
